Joe Thomas somehow named every starting quarterback he has protected during his Cleveland Browns career

Joe Thomas has played with a lot of quarterbacks over the 10,000 snaps of his career

The Cleveland Browns have seen a lot of turnover at the quarterback position over the years, but for over a decade now one man has been there to protect whoever was lining up under center: left tackle Joe Thomas.

A pro-bowler every year of his career since being drafted by the Browns with the third overall pick in 2007, Thomas has been one of the few constants in a franchise that can appear to outside observers to be in constant upheaval.

Thomas' consistency is something unheard of in the NFL — he hasn't missed a game, or even a single play for the entirety of his 10-year career — and on Sunday he passed the milestone of playing 10,000 consecutive snaps for the Browns.

It's an impressive feat for any athlete, but it feels especially astounding coming from the Cleveland Browns, whose quarterback situation has been so volatile that the winningest QB in Cleveland since 1999 is actually Ben Roethlisberger of the Steelers.

Despite so many men taking the reigns behind him over the course of his career, Thomas has proven to be a thoughtful teammate. In a recent piece for E:60, ESPN's Jeremy Schaap quizzed Thomas to see if he could name all 18 starting quarterbacks that he had protected in his career with the Browns. He succeeded with flying colors.

While Thomas has a good recall of those who have started behind him, so many backups have come in for the Browns that he once had to introduce himself mid-game.

As Cleveland.com reported last year, in Week 17 of the 2012 season starter Thaddeus Lewis was sacked and knocked out of the game. With the Browns still in striking distance and facing fourth-and-nine, backup Josh Johnson came in to try and get the first down, having just been signed by the team two days earlier.

Thomas recalls getting back to the huddle and realizing he didn't know the man he was protecting.
